Lagos Court Grants Emefiele N50m Bail

Godwin Emefiele, a former governor of the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N), has been granted N50 million in bail by a high court in Ikeja, Lagos.

In his decision on the bail application on Friday, Judge Rahmon Oshodi allowed Emefiele on bond along with two sureties in the same amount.

The former governor of the Central Bank of Nigeria is on trial in Lagos on 26 counts related to alleged official abuse.

Oshodi held that the sureties must be gainfully employed and have three years of tax payment with the Lagos State Government.

He also ordered that the sureties must show proper identification and they must be registered in the Lagos State Bail Management System.
